    C. J. Stroud: biography

    C.J. Stroud is a football player who currently plays as a quarterback for the Houston Texans of the National Football League.

    Childhood and youth

    C.J. Stroud was born on October 3, 2001, in Rancho Cucamonga, California. Growing up, he was interested in sports and played basketball and football.

    As a child, Stroud would often watch football games with his family, and he started playing organized football in the local Pop Warner league when he was just six years old. He continued to play football throughout his childhood and into high school, where he became one of the top quarterbacks in the country.

    In high school, Stroud played for Rancho Cucamonga High School, where he put up impressive numbers and led his team to multiple playoff appearances. He was named the Baseline League Offensive Player of the Year in his junior and senior seasons and was also named a finalist for the California Gatorade Player of the Year Award.

    On April 27, 2023, C.J. Stroud was drafted by the Houston Texans in the 2023 NFL Draft, which marked a major accomplishment in his football career.
